The search term "Clash of Kings private server files" refers to the unauthorized server-side source code and databases required to host an emulated version of the mobile strategy game Clash of Kings (CoK). These files allow third parties to create "private servers"—unofficial game environments often modified to provide free in-game currency or advantages. Possessing, distributing, or using these files carries significant legal risks, cybersecurity threats, and operational liabilities.
